Appearance Adjectives to Describe People
Be careful using negative adjectives when commenting on a person’s appearance, as some people may be very offended by them!
In most situations, it is safer to use a neutral or positive adjective. For example, you should you “slender” instead of “thin“, “large” instead of “fat“.
